The winner's ranking points are the same as the ranking of the event, so that major winners get 100 ranking points. The second place golfer gets 60% of this amount, 40% for 3rd, 30% for 4th, 24% for 5th, down to 14% for 10th, 7% for 20th, 3.5% for 40th to 1.5% for 60th.

How do points work in the official World Golf Ranking?

In the Official World Golf Ranking, it can range from 2 points for the winner and one other player getting points to 100 points for the winner of a major and all players making the cut getting points. The points earned retain their full value for 13 weeks, then the depreciate over the next 91 weeks in equal installments until the come off entirely.

What is the official World Golf Ranking?

The Official World Golf Ranking is a system for rating the performance level of professional golfers. It was started in 1986.The rankings are based on a player's position in individual tournaments (i.e. not pairs or team events) over a "rolling" two-year period. New rankings are produced each week.

Which tournaments are eligible for World Ranking points?

Official Tournaments from the leading professional Eligible Golf Tours from around the world as well as Major Championships, World Golf Championships, Olympic Golf Competition and the World Cup of Golf are eligible for World Ranking Points (excluding team events).

How are points awarded in golf rankings?

Calculations. The rankings are based on performance over a two-year period. The ranking shows a player's average points per tournament, his total points earned divided by the number of tournaments he has competed in.

How often are the world golf rankings updated?

The Official World Golf Rankings are updated every Monday after the latest weekend tournaments across the world. The latest standings are below and updated live, featuring the world standings and top 10 ranked players.

How long was Tiger Woods number 1 in the world?

281 weeksTiger Woods had topped the rankings a total of 11 times, with his reign of 281 weeks between 12 June 2005 and 30 October 2010 the longest consecutive streak. His cumulative time spent at No. 1 – more than 13 years – is twice that of the next-best golfer, Greg Norman (331 weeks).

What is divisor in golf?

A key factor in the calculation of the points is what is known as the divisor. This is a figure by which a player's total points are divided, and it's based on the number of events a player plays in. The figure ranges from 40-52, with 40 the minimum divisor.

Which golf clubs accept the World Golf Rankings?

Golf’s major governing bodies, such as the United States Golf Association and the Professional Golfers’ Association of America, as well as hosts of the world’s four major championships, including the Royal & Ancient Club and Augusta National Golf Club accept the World Golf Rankings.

How many points does the BMW PGA Championship have?

The champion of the BMW PGA Championship on the European Tour receives at least 64 points. By comparison, winning a standard PGA Tour or European Tour event earns the winner 24 points.

How long do golf points stay on a player's tally?

Points remain on a player’s tally for two years (up to a maximum of 52 events played during that time), but they’re reduced on a sliding scale after 13 weeks, so recent performances carry greater weight.

What does it mean to score well in golf?

Scoring well in the rankings is a golfer’s ticket to the world’s most prestigious tournaments. For example, the Masters accepts the top 50 players from the previous year’s rankings, plus the top 50 from the most recent rankings prior to the Masters.

When was McCormack's golf ranking published?

McCormack published his rankings from 1968 to 1985 in his book “The World of Professional Golf Annual.”. Today, the rankings are issued weekly.

When did the British Open rankings start?

Origin. The official rankings began to be published in 1986. The Royal and Ancient Golf Club of St. Andrews devised the system as a more equitable way to select players to be invited to the British Open. The rankings were inspired by an earlier unofficial ranking system developed by sports agent Mark McCormack, whose clients included Arnold Palmer.
